After nine years of waiting, a new Closure In Moscow album officially lives

Closure In Moscow seem to be aiming for the Australian version of Tool, or GNR, or any other band that takes a significantly long time to drop a new record. With a nine-year gap between albums two and three, fans have been waiting a while, but we are happy to say that the new album, Soft Hell, has officially been launched.

Two local solo electronic acts opened the evening, starting with Niine, an eclectic artist who pushed powerful vocals over drumless deep bass synths. Add in a PJ Harvey cover and a guitar-only banger, and the scene was set for the second support, Closure In Moscow collaborator Aphir. An artist who appears on two Soft Hell tracks, Aphir co-wrote and produced the new album and offered a set of stunning minimal electronica with gentle vocals.

The mood shifted when Closure took the stage with the first track from the new album Jaeger Bomb. A band that definitely gets funkier in their live show every year, it was clear the five-piece were happy to be in front of the sold-out crowd with new tunes. The set went round and round with new and old with A Night at the Spleen, Primal Sinister and Kissing Cousins, but his a power crescendo with the now-classic, Sweet#hart.

While the band has dabbled with live performances over their nine-year album break, the downtime seems to have made them tighter, groovier and heavier all in one. Special mention goes to guitarist Mansur Zennelli, who impressed everyone with some tricky vocal parts over even trickier guitar riffs. Closure In Moscow are currently at their best, and the new album is even better live, so be sure to catch their next offering.
